First World War guard officer Capt. G.W.Bulling, Knockaloe Camp, Isle of Man

Date(s): ?1918

Scope & Content: Hut plaque reads 'Capt G.W.Bulling'. In the London Gazette of 20 November 1919, Captain G.W.Bulling, of the Protection Companies, Royal Defence Corps announced he had relinquished his commission. He was appointed captain in the gazette of 30 December 1916, thus providing a date frame for the photograph. In a newspaper report of 1921, Captain G.W.Bulling is reported as the manager of a factory in the Preston area.
